The Pros and Cons of Buying New
When it comes to gaming, having a powerful and reliable gaming PC is essential. But with so many options available, it can be difficult to decide whether to invest in a brand new system or go for a refurbished one. Advantages of Buying New
1. Latest Technology: One of the biggest advantages of buying a new gaming PC is that you get access to the latest technology. Newer models often come equipped with faster processors, more advanced graphics cards, and better cooling systems, allowing you to enjoy the latest games with maximum performance and visual quality.
2. Warranty Protection: Another benefit of purchasing a new gaming PC is the warranty protection that comes with it. Most reputable manufacturers offer a warranty of at least one year, which covers any potential hardware issues that may arise. This gives you peace of mind and ensures that you won’t have to bear the cost of repairs or replacements during the warranty period.
3. Customization Options: Buying a new gaming PC also gives you the flexibility to customize your system according to your preferences. Whether it’s choosing a specific processor, upgrading the RAM, or selecting a larger storage capacity, you have the freedom to tailor the specifications to meet your gaming needs.
Disadvantages of Buying New
1. Higher Cost: The primary drawback of purchasing a new gaming PC is the higher cost. New systems tend to be more expensive compared to their refurbished counterparts, as you are paying a premium for the latest technology and the warranty protection. This option may not be suitable for gamers on a tight budget.
2. Limited Deals and Discounts: Buying a brand new gaming PC may not offer as many deals and discounts as the refurbished market. Retailers often provide more attractive offers on refurbished systems in order to clear their inventory, making it a more cost-effective choice for gamers who want to save some money.
The Pros and Cons of Buying Refurbished
Now, let’s explore the advantages and disadvantages of buying a refurbished gaming PC. Refurbished systems are those that have been returned, repaired, and tested to ensure they are in good working condition.
Advantages of Buying Refurbished
1. Lower Cost: The most significant advantage of buying a refurbished gaming PC is the lower cost. Refurbished systems are typically priced lower than their brand new counterparts, making them an attractive option for gamers who are on a tight budget or looking to save some money.
2. Good as New: Contrary to popular belief, refurbished gaming PCs are often as good as new. These systems undergo thorough testing and repairs to ensure they function properly. They are often backed by a limited warranty, giving you additional peace of mind.
3. Access to Older Models: If you prefer a particular model that is no longer available as new, buying refurbished allows you to get your hands on it. This can be especially beneficial if you have specific hardware requirements or compatibility needs.
Disadvantages of Buying Refurbished
1. Limited Availability: Compared to new systems, the availability of refurbished gaming PCs may be more limited. Since they are dependent on returns and repairs, the options can vary. You may have to spend some time searching for the specific specifications or model you desire.
2. Potential Wear and Tear: While refurbished gaming PCs are repaired and tested, there is still a chance that they may have some wear and tear. Although the repairs aim to fix any issues, it’s crucial to thoroughly research the refurbishment process and buy from reputable sellers to minimize the risk of receiving a subpar system.
Conclusion
Choosing between a new or refurbished gaming PC ultimately depends on your budget, gaming needs, and personal preferences. If you prioritize the latest technology, warranty protection, and customization options, a new system may be the right choice for you. However, if you are willing to compromise on the latest technology and want to save some money, a refurbished gaming PC can provide a cost-effective solution without sacrificing performance. Whichever option you choose, make sure to do your research, read reviews, and purchase from reputable sellers to ensure you get the best gaming experience for your money.
